Capital Sci-Fi Con takes place at the Edinburgh Corn Exchange on 15th, 16th, 17th February 2019 and bringing the soundtrack for the party is a DJ who has worked Celebration, Rancho Obi-Wan and more.

We are super pleased to announce that returning to Capital Sci fi Con 2019 all the way from Orlando, Florida is Disney DJ Elliot!

DJ Elliott is the official Star Wars Celebration DJ!

He specializes in nerdcentric entertainment and his musical stylings range from EDM, MashUps, Top40, and anything that can get people moving.

He can be found at various pop culture events, from Star Wars Celebration, NYCC, C2E2, Rock in Rio and returning to Capital Sci fi once more!

Dj Elliott will be Dj-Ing at the following:
Big Nerd Quiz and Karaoke: Friday Night.
Meal with the Stars: Saturday night.
Baron Suite: Saturday and Sunday.

Elliot joins fellow guests Mike Quinn, Warwick Davis, Jerome Blake, Chris Parsons, Kiran Shah, Katy Kartwheel, Aidan Cook and Lewis Macleod. Fantha Tracks are there covering the show, so be sure to say hi when you see us on the show floor.
